A man has been arrested in connection with Saturday’s fatal shooting, Santa Maria police Lt. Jesse Silva said Thursday.
At 4:30 p.m. Jan. 2, officers were dispatched to a shooting in the 900 block of West El Camino Street.
The victim, Kevin Alan Najarro, 35, of Santa Maria was declared dead at the scene after being shot multiple times, Silva said.
Patrol officers and detectives immediately launched an investigation, working through the weekend “with great success,” Silva added.
Evidence located during the investigation led to the arrest of Robert Anthony Molina, 35, of Santa Maria, as the alleged shooter, police said.
Police found Molina at an apartment in the 200 block of North Depot Street and took him into custody.
Detectives remained mum about the motive for the shooting but say it is not believed to be related to gang activity.
“We are grateful to members of the community who offered assistance,” Silva said. “This case would not have not been possible without your truly meaningful contributions.”

Molina has been booked into the Santa Barbara County Jail with bail set at $3 million.
